- W4385429221 abstract "The recently reported unidirectional guided resonances (UGRs) in asymmetric photonic crystal (PhC) slabs exhibit ultrahigh unidirectional radiation. Radiation on one side of the PhC slab at a particular direction is allowed while that on the other side is perfectly canceled. The UGR was previously explained as the single side far field polarization singularity. Here the formation mechanism of UGRs is explained from the viewpoint of multipole radiation. Two types of UGR are considered with one induced from the bound state in the continuum and the other arising from the avoided crossings of two guided resonances. The first type of UGR, similar to the Brewster effect, arises from the overlap of the null direction of the dipolelike radiation with the system radiation channel. The second type of UGR stems from the intermixing of multipoles in the two original bands which modifies the radiation singularities, resulting in the single side radiation in one of the newly formed bands. Our results provide an alternative perspective for the understanding of UGRs by connecting the near field information and the far field radiation." @default.
